OpenStudio App 1.1.0 Failed to Save

Anyone else get this error EVERY time they save the model:

image description

It is very annoying. It always ends up saving the model anyway.

Could it be that you have the OpenStudio directory of your model opened in windows explorer or something else? For example, if your model is saved in "MyModel.osm", there's a directory "MyModel" that is auto-created by the OpenStudioApplication. When you save, it tries to rewrite everything and it looks like some file is locked by another process.

Thank you Adrien. You make a good point. I have tried it such that the only application I have open is OpenStudio and I still get the same error message. I suspect it is because the files are located on a folder connected to the cloud. When I move the files to my desktop, the problem seems to go away.

This occurs by using too long osm filenames.

This was the problem for me, after shortening the file name it managed to save the file.
